In the age of COVID, webinars are of course hot. Instead of having conferences or face-to-face meetups, events are being held online and virtually. Before 2020, webinar software was already big, now most online businesses could use webinar software in some capacity.
Even though webinars are somewhat overused, they are still an effective means to convert leads into customers. One could argue every digital business or high ticket item should add a webinar to their sales funnel.
Webinars are a great medium to do many things. You can use a webinar for:
- Live Events — Virtual conferences and mastermind events.
- Automated Webinars — Just-in-time webinar where it may appear live to the attendee.
- Product Demos — Showcase your product to prospective customers
- Customer Training — Create a how-to for existing customers to effectively use your product
- Internal Communications — Educate your employees and consultants on SOPs (Standard Operating Procedures)
- Online Courses — Train individuals live or with pre-recorded sessions.
The possibilities are limitless with webinars.
The biggest disadvantage of a live webinar is the ability to scale. With live webinars, you must be present to perform the webinar. One of the newer methods to sell with is with an automated webinar.
A pre-recorded automated webinar allows you to schedule times when it’s best for your attendees to watch your webinar. You create an automated webinar and can sell your product or service 24/7. Though I typically only recommend automating a webinar once you’ve got the sales funnel and conversions at an acceptable level.
Automated webinars are great because you scale your product or service and allow it to sell any you send traffic to your webinar.

The biggest advantage to Demio compared to the popular WebinarJam is the lack of a 30-second delay. Demio’s webinars are near real-time, allow you to better interact with your audience and in HD video. The other benefit over WebinarJam and EverWebinar is Demio’s service has live webinars and automated webinars combined into one service.

WebinarJam is a live-only webinar service. If you are looking to create automated webinars, their sister service EverWebinar can do automated webinars. Both services are by Genesis Digital LLC and also the maker of all-in-one service Kartra.
Features
- Live Chat — Communicate with your audience via private and public comments. Create sticky announcements and highlight previous comments.
- Flexible Scheduling — Run your webinars at the anytime you want.
- Email and SMS Built-in — While works with many email marketing software, it is an option with WebinarJam and can use their built-in Email and SMS reminders.
- Present Offers — Present offers to your webinar attendees for a limited time.
- Drawing Board — Write notes and messages on top of your presentation or screen share to highlight parts.
- Paid Webinars — A unique feature of WebinarJam is the ability to accept payment for the webinar without using a third-party shopping cart service.

Unlike EverWebinar, WebinarJam does have differences in their three plan options.
WebinarJam has a 30-day money back guarantee.
The primary differences is with the Professional plan you have an always-on live room. This gives you a fixed URL link so existing audiences can use the same URL to access their training.
The other big option is a “panic button” option for the Professional and Enterprise plans. If there’s a technical glitch in your presentation, you can do a hard reset and start over again with your same attendees.
Otherwise, the only difference in plans is the duration but for most with the Basic plan, 2 hours max duration for live webinar is more than enough time.

In the past year Zoom has taken off as a company. They specialize in live meeting and perfect for that usage. Though should use also use Zoom for their Webinar software?
Zoom’s webinar software is primarily for the training and education of existing customers. If you using it for part of your sales funnel you’ll be disappointed in Zoom’s options. For example, it lacks any functionality to automate your webinars. As a lead-gen tool I would suggest avoiding Zoom.
Zoom can be great if live for live events like virtual conferences and mastermind groups. It supports large audience sizes.

The sister service of GoToMeeting, GoToWebinar is a fully featured live and automated webinar SaaS. GoToWebinar is one of the oldest services listed in the group. In order to view a webinar, you must download and install GoToMeeting’s software. Which for some can be a deterrent from watching your webinar.
